Sports Drinks, Bars, Or Gels:
Which Are Best?
There are so many products out there that claim they will enhance
athletic performance. Three commonly used products are: sports drinks,
energy bars, and energy gels. Are there benefits to using one over
the other? Let's take a look . . .
Research has been done on all of the above products. Keep in mind;
however, there are many brands of each product, and research may
not have been conducted on all products sold. In general, using
a sports drink has been shown to not only improve performance, but,
in one study, runners who drank the sports drink ran faster and
felt that the race was easier compared to runners who drank a placebo.
Note: It is important that a placebo is used in studies in order
to be sure that the changes that a researcher observes are due to
the effects of the intervention, not just by chance.
As far as energy gels are concerned, research has also shown that
they may be helpful for athletes, too. A recent study conducted
at California State University at Sacramento compared the use of
a gel to a placebo. Although the researchers did not assess performance,
they did report that there were higher levels of blood glucose (sugar)
in the athletes who consumed the gel compared to the placebo group.
One can speculate that this higher blood glucose will be used for
energy, and thus, spare stored carbohydrate, called "glycogen
", in the muscle. Since the gels do not provide fluids, it
is important to drink plenty of fluids, as well.
How do energy bars rate? Well, several researchers have investigated
the effectiveness of solid versus liquid carbohydrates. It doesnít
seem to matter if you take in solid or liquid carbohydrates, but,
it does matter that you also drink water with solid carbohydrates.
If athletes like the taste of energy bars, it may be worthwhile
for athletes to try them; since they are convenient and athletes
can keep several energy bars in their sports bag for quick energy
boosts.
